Karkajmy [karˈkai̯mɨ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Orneta, within Lidzbark County, Warmian-Masurian Voivodeship, in northern Poland.[1] It lies approximately 5 kilometres (3 mi) south-west of Orneta, 33 km (21 mi) west of Lidzbark Warmiński, and 44 km (27 mi) north-west of the regional capital Olsztyn.

Before 1772 the area was part of the Kingdom of Poland, and in 1772–1945 it belonged to Prussia and Germany (East Prussia).
